5.2.3 Switching Modes 

At the main interface, you can switch between the modes of cooling, economic heating, heating & rapid heating by 
pressing 

 . Example: Switch from Cooling mode to Economic Heating 

 

Note: The operation of mode is invalid if the unit you purchase is heating only or cooling only. 

5.2.4 System State Checking 

At any interface you can enter the system working state by pressing   TWICE, then using the UP and Down arrow 
keys to highlight the required parameter, then press 

 to enter. To exit, press the ON/OFF button 

 

5.2.5 Changing Temperature 

At the main interface, press the UP or DOWN key to adjust the temperature setting as desired. Once complete, press 
the 

 button to save the settings and exit. Press the ON/OFF button to exit without saving settings. Refer to the 

Parameter Table to set relevant temperature. 

 

5.2.6 Clock Setting 

At the main interface press   to enter the clock setting interface. Select the parameter you wish to change and 
press   to make the parameter begin flashing which indicates it can be changed. Press the UP or DOWN keys to 
change the parameter value, then press   to save. Press the ON/OFF button to return to the main menu. 

 

Note: If there is no operation after 10 seconds, it will return to the main menu and changes will automatically be saved.  

To change the date, the same process is followed.
